Mediterranean Quinoa Salad with Greek Flavors

This Mediterranean quinoa salad is a nutritious and flavorful dish that combines the goodness of quinoa with classic Greek ingredients. It’s perfect as a side dish or a light main course.

The recipe is simple and can be prepared in advance, making it ideal for meal prep or gatherings. Feel free to customize it with your favorite vegetables or proteins.

Ingredients That Shine

The Mediterranean quinoa salad is a delightful combination of fresh ingredients that not only provide vibrant colors but also a variety of textures and flavors.

Fluffy quinoa serves as the base, offering a nutty flavor and a satisfying bite.

Complementing the quinoa are diced cucumbers, which add a refreshing crunch, and halved cherry tomatoes that bring a burst of sweetness.

Kalamata olives introduce a briny depth, while crumbled feta cheese adds creaminess and tang.

Finally, fresh parsley brightens the dish, making it visually appealing and aromatic.

Preparation Made Simple

Creating this salad is a straightforward process that can be completed in about 30 minutes.

Start by cooking the quinoa until it’s fluffy and has absorbed all the liquid.

While the quinoa cools, prepare the dressing by whisking together olive oil, lemon juice, oregano, salt, and pepper.

This zesty dressing is what ties all the flavors together, enhancing the freshness of the vegetables.

Mixing It All Together

Once the quinoa has cooled, it’s time to combine all the ingredients.

In a large bowl, mix the quinoa with the diced cucumbers, cherry tomatoes, red onion, olives, feta cheese, and parsley.

Pour the dressing over the mixture and toss gently to ensure everything is evenly coated.

This step is crucial for achieving a harmonious blend of flavors.

Serving Suggestions

This Mediterranean quinoa salad can be enjoyed in various ways.

It makes a fantastic side dish for grilled meats or can stand alone as a light main course.

For those looking to enhance their meal, consider adding grilled chicken or chickpeas for extra protein.

Chilling the salad for about 30 minutes before serving allows the flavors to meld beautifully.

Health Benefits

Beyond its vibrant appearance, this salad is packed with nutritional benefits.

Quinoa is a complete protein, making it an excellent choice for vegetarians and those seeking healthy grains.

The fresh vegetables contribute essential vitamins and minerals, while olives and feta provide healthy fats.

This dish is not only satisfying but also supports a balanced diet.

Easy Greek Flavored Quinoa Salad Recipe

This quinoa salad features fluffy quinoa mixed with fresh vegetables, feta cheese, olives, and a zesty lemon-olive oil dressing. It takes about 30 minutes to prepare and serves 4 people.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up quinoa, rinsed
  • 2 cups water or vegetable broth
  • 1 medium cucumber, diced
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1/2 red onion, finely chopped
  • 1/2 cup Kalamata olives, pitted and sliced
  • 1/2 cup feta cheese, crumbled
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Cook the Quinoa: In a medium saucepan, combine quinoa and water or broth.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es or until quinoa is fluffy and liquid is absorbed. Remove from heat and let it cool.
  2. Prepare the D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, oregano, salt, and pepper.
  3. Combine 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the cooked quinoa, cucumber, cherry tomatoes, red onion, olives, feta cheese, and parsley.
  4. Add Dressing: Pour the dressing over the quinoa mixture and toss gently to combine.
  5. Serve: Enjoy the salad immediately or refrigerate for 30 minutes to allow flavors to meld. Serve chilled or at room temperature.

Cook and Prep Times

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Servings: 4 servings
  • Calories: 250kcal
  • Fat: 15g
  • Protein: 8g
  • Carbohydrates: 27g
